My 1976 home in Donaldsonville has water-damaged plaster. Why is lead testing required before you start demolition?

Homes built before the 1978 federal cutoff, like many in our area, are presumed to contain lead-based paint. The EPA's Renovation, Repair, and Painting (RRP) Rule is federally mandated. Before any demolition of painted surfaces, a certified test must be performed. Disturbing materials without lead-safe containment and disposal protocols carries significant fines and creates a Category 3 environmental hazard.

Why does my floor in Downtown Donaldsonville feel dry but my restoration contractor says it's still wet?

Surface 'dryness' is a sensory illusion. Water migrates via vapor pressure into porous structural materials like subflooring and studs. The IICRC S500 standard of care requires drying to a psychrometric equilibrium, which for our climate is approximately 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. We verify this with penetrating moisture meters, not touch. Inadequate drying creates a reservoir for future mold and rot.

What is the first thing I should do when I discover a major water leak near the Ascension Parish Courthouse?

The first action is to immediately shut off the main water supply valve to stop the flow. This is the critical step in 'loss of use' mitigation. Then, contact your utility provider to secure the service. Rapid water shutoff limits the volume and category of the water, directly reducing the scope of restoration, potential for structural compromise, and the final claim severity.

My insurer said I had a 'Category 3' water loss from storm surge. What does that mean for my claim and my premium?

Category 3, or 'black water,' contains unsanitary agents like bacteria and sewage, typical of flood and storm surge events in Zone AE. This requires a more extensive, antimicrobial remediation protocol. Conversely, installing IoT leak sensors (e.g., Moen Flo) can provide a 5-8% premium credit in Louisiana by enabling early detection of 'clean' Category 1 leaks, preventing them from degrading into Category 3 losses.

How soon after a leak must water damage mitigation begin to prevent mold?

The microbial growth window is 48-72 hours under ideal conditions. As of 2026, insurance carriers and liability standards view a failure to initiate documented mitigation within this window as a deviation from the Standard of Care. This can shift liability for subsequent mold remediation costs away from the insurer and onto the property owner. Immediate action is a financial and health imperative.
